When Should You Consider Mini Split Replacement in Deer Park?

Your mini split is a complex system that gradually loses efficiency and reliability over time. Understanding when replacement is the best course can save you money and prevent unexpected system failures during critical weather.

Common signs indicating mini split replacement is necessary include:

  • Age of the Unit: Most mini split systems last between 10 and 15 years. Units older than this often struggle to perform efficiently and may be more prone to breakdowns.
  • Loss of Efficiency: If you notice rising energy bills or inconsistent temperatures, it might signal your system is no longer operating at peak efficiency.
  • Recurring Repairs: Frequent repair calls for the same or related issues often mean it's more economical to replace the system rather than keep patching older parts.
  • Refrigerant Leaks or Compressor Failures: These can be costly repairs and may not be wise to undertake on aging systems given current energy efficiency standards.
  • Noisy Operation or Poor Airflow: Declining comfort levels, loud noises, or poor airflow may indicate underlying system wear that replacement can resolve.

Choosing the Right Mini Split System for Your Deer Park Home

Replacing a mini split isn’t just about swapping out old equipment; it’s an opportunity to upgrade to a system perfectly tailored for your home’s needs and Deer Park’s local climate challenges.

Single-Zone vs. Multi-Zone Mini Splits

  • Single-Zone Systems cool or heat one specific area and are ideal for small spaces, additions, or rooms without ductwork.
  • Multi-Zone Systems connect multiple indoor units to one outdoor compressor, offering customized zone control in different rooms or floors, which is perfect for larger or multi-room homes.

Efficiency Tiers and Energy Savings

Mini splits are rated by SEER (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io) and HSPF (Heating Seasonal Performance Factor). Choosing higher efficiency units means:

  • Lower utility bills in Deer Park's hot summers and sporadic winter chill.
  • Eligibility for local energy incentive programs.
  • Reduced environmental footprint.

Mini Split Removal, Disposal, and Code Compliance

Properly replacing your mini split requires safe removal and disposal of the old system according to local and state regulations.

  • Safe Refrigerant Recovery: We ensure refrigerants are responsibly recovered and recycled, avoiding environmental harm.
  • Disposal of Old Units: We handle all disposal logistics so you avoid any environmental or legal liabilities.

Mini Split Replacement Costs and Financing Options in Deer Park

The total cost of mini split replacement depends on several factors:

  • Size and capacity of the new system
  • Number of zones (single vs. multi-zone)
  • Brand and efficiency tier
  • Installation complexity (e.g., refrigerant line length, electrical work, permits)
  • Removal and disposal fees for the old system
